Wamena, Jubi – The Jayawijaya Legislative Council has not determined its stance on the polemic surrounding plans to build Mobile Brigade police headquarters in the regency.

Council chairman Taufik Petrus Latuihammalo said made the remarks during a Jayawijaya Parliamentary Special Meeting on Monday (11/5/2015).

He said the Council’s Commission A for government, development, security, legal and human right affairs argued that several stages are required and should be completed prior to the final conclusion. Therefore, he expected the parliament’s factions would be able to bring their opinion in the plenary session phase II.

Meanwhile, the Jayawijaya Regent Wempi Wetipo earlier said the government so far had not received any objections from local residents of 40 sub-districts in Jayawijaya Regency related to this issue.
